In the "old days" anyone on active duty could consume alcohol on military installations, regardless of the legal drinking age off-base.
However, in the mid-80s, advocacy groups, such as MADD (Mothers Against Drunken Drivers) lobbied Congress to change this. Federal law now requires military installation commanders to adopt the same drinking age as the state the military base is located in. There are some exceptions to the law, however.
